FINANCE REVIEW SUMMARY — Heads of Department
Subject: Proposed joint venture with Talverine Industries

The proposal covers co-development of the Skellway logistics platform, with capital contributions split 60/40 in our favour and governance shared equally. Projected breakeven is month nineteen. Due diligence flagged no material issues beyond Talverine's pension liabilities. The strategic rationale is outlined directly below.

board note of kageg-bahof: The renewal with Holwynax Holdings closes at $2 million a year, 5 percent below the last contract. Project Ulaath slips by two quarters because of the supplier delay.

Subject: Template rendering just got snappier

Hey plugin folks! The Quillmark 4.2 release cuts template render times by roughly 40% thanks to the new precompile cache. No API changes needed on your end, but do re-run your benchmarks before shipping. The build this applies to is tagged below.

build token for tawip-yageg: htk9_92ac43d42

Changelog — Verdantrix greenhouse controller, build 4.2.1. Fixed: humidity sensor drift after 72h uptime. Root cause: calibration offset accumulated in the Mosswatch sampling loop; values skewed up to 8% before reset. Change: recalibration now runs every 6h instead of on boot only. Impact: drift alerts from zones 3–5 should stop. Watch for false lows during the first recalibration cycle post-deploy. Rollback: pin build 4.1.9. Escalate drift recurrences to the engineer named below.

account owner for bawip-tahag: Raleth Quenok